Deepwater Containment and Response

Witnesses testified about the future of offshore oil exploration and lessons learned from the Deepwater Horizon oil rig accident. Among the topics they addressed were enhancements to safety procedures and equipment, cooperation among government agencies and private companies, and contingency plans for future oil spill accidents. close
